Q: Is 15,441,468 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 15,441,468 is a composite number.

Why is 15,441,468 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 15,441,468 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 7 12 14 21 28 42 49 84 98 147 196 294 588 26,261 52,522 78,783 105,044 157,566 183,827 315,132 367,654 551,481 735,308 1,102,962 1,286,789 2,205,924 2,573,578 3,860,367 5,147,156 7,720,734 and 15,441,468, with no remainder.

Since 15,441,468 cannot be divided by just 1 and 15,441,468, it is a composite number.
